Network Strategy Analyst
CVS Health is positioned as the nation’s premier health innovation company. Through our health services, insurance plans and community pharmacists, we’re pioneering a bold new approach to total health. As a CVS Health colleague, you’ll be at the center of it all!
Position Summary:
The manager-level analyst of Networks Strategy will be responsible for analyzing, building, and maintaining financial and operational tools to support organizational understanding of the network value and its flow into underwriting modeling. The motivated and detail-oriented manager will deploy capabilities to increase both automation and data accuracy.
A candidate on this team will perform a variety of ad-hoc analyses in response to specific business questions and will have the opportunity to present to and work in collaboration with internal business partners, such as Network Development, Pricing/Underwriting, Operations, and Finance.
The Manager, Network Strategy will:
- Create and maintain BigQuery / SQL processes to integrate with master claims tables to fit the needs of cost of goods modeling. Create standard data summary outputs that will help understand trends.
- Develop and support Excel and Tableau based financial impact reports or dashboards that assist in leadership decision making and strategy.
- Build Excel models to answer business questions and help model and quantify network value.
- Other ad hoc financial modeling and duties as assigned
Required Qualifications
- 5+ years of analytical experience in network, contracting, pricing, and/or finance
- 3+ years experience in Specialty Pharmacy, PBM, or related healthcare field
- Experience utilizing Excel, including formulas, VLOOKUP's, pivot tables
- Experience with SQL and Data Visualization
Preferred Qualifications
- 3+ years of experience in Pharmaceutical data management
- 3+ Advanced Excel knowledge including formulas, VLOOKUP's, pivot tables
- 3+ Experience with BigQuery/SQL, Dataiku programming languages (Python/R), and Data Visualization
- 3+ Demonstrated proficiency in MS Office Suite Products (Word, Outlook, Excel, PowerPoint)
- Ability to work independently, meet deadlines, and manage competing demands
- Experience working cross-functionally in an organization.
- Reporting and data analytics experience
Educational Requirements
- Bachelors degree or equivalent work experience required

The typical pay range for this role is:
$66,330.00 - $145,860.00This pay range represents the base hourly rate or base annual full-time salary for all positions in the job grade within which this position falls. The actual base salary offer will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education, geography and other relevant factors. This position is eligible for a CVS Health bonus, commission or short-term incentive program in addition to the base pay range listed above.
